Everybody knows how busy the holidays can be. But that’s no reason to let yourself get caught in the trap of not exercising to make more time for holiday errands or events. According to BJ Bliffert, it is a big mistake to risk losing the lean muscle, strength and endurance that you may have worked for months to build and maintain. He claims: “Losses in lean muscle mass will lower your resting metabolic rate, which accounts for the vast majority (about 60-75%) of your total daily calorie burning. This means that everyday you will be burning less and less calories which may allow those dreaded holiday pounds unwanted body fat to creep up on you. Before you know it you try on wear favorite jeans, but they seem to have shrunk. Really it’s the other way around!”
BJ Bliffert provides four quick down and dirty fitness tips to help you keep your body flab-free as this holiday season:
1.) Perform at least one intense strength training session per week
Studies show that one single strength workout per week during times when you cannot train as frequently or as you normally do is an effective way to reduce loss of strength halp maintain your current levels of strength and lean muscle mass.
2.) Try Mini Workouts
Look for hidden chunks of time during the day to get in a certain number of daily repetitions for a certain number of exercises that work your entire body (e.g. 10 push-ups, 10 squats, etc.). Using this method throughout the day will lead lot of reps by the end of the day that will burn nearly same amount of calories. Remember, this isn’t optimal, but it’s better than nothing. I use this method when my client load get too high and lack time.
3.) Don’t rely on machines
Machines have made us an incredibly out of shape, overweight and not to mention lazy society. Do your best this holiday season stay on your feet as much as possible and resist the temptation to let a machine do the work for you. Take the stairs, not the elevator.
4.) Get outdoors
Be it snowball fights, a friendly game of football, or whatever other winter activity floats your boat, get outside, have fun, and move with a purpose as much as possible.
